I filed BK7 a little over 2 years ago. File date is 3/14/05. I have a CA called ANFI showing up on me CR with an opened date of 3/31/05 and report date of 5/23/05 - after my filing. OC is Sprint and proper paperwork was filed with them and the CA who was involved at time of BK filing. Not sure what steps to take to remove. The CR is showing that BK7 was filed in regards to this account, but CA opened file after my original BK filing date so wondering if I could get removed? They have reported to the big 3 CRAs.

direred meant send to CA first THEN send to CRA.

This is known as the 1-2 punch. BTW, I had a lot of CAs get an account on me after my BK7. I wrote them AND the CRAs stating that the OC was in the list of creditors.....that sending the acct to the CA was a violation of BK law and that the account was/is illegal from inception! This debt was discharged before CA got it so there IS NO BALANCE!

it's a violation of the automatic stay.

No, it's a violation of the Discharge Injunction. Stay ends when the bankruptcy is over.

Actually, to preserve your rights, you need to dispute with the CRA FIRST, then if it comes back as 'verified' you dispute directly with the CA - unless Momof5 meant that as DVing the CA first - I wouldn't bother.

Either way, reporting a collection on a discharged debt is a violation- doesn't matter when AFNI acquired the bad paper (your old debt), it's still completely uncollectable !

This is the letter I am sending to Experian and Equifax. I disputed with Transunion online so if they deny my request I will be sending them the same letter (disputed on grounds it wasn't my debt - checkbox system they use to dispute doesn't give you a lot of detailed choices)

_____________________________________________________________

I recently received a copy of my credit report and have found what appears to be an illegal entry. This needs to be corrected before it causes any further harm to my credit.

ANFI, Inc is showing a collection account #xxxx45016 for Sprint in the amount of $xxx. This item was opened on 3/31/05 which is after my Chapter 7 bankruptcy filing of 3/xx/05. This appears to be a violation of bankruptcy law, since Sprint was properly notified of the bankruptcy filing before the date ANFI is showing for the open account and was prohibited by law from further collection activities - which included turning the account over to ANFI for collection.

This collection account needs to be deleted from my credit report immediately. It is the duty of all Credit Reporting Agencies to provide accurate information and this is clearly not an item that should be appearing on my report at all. I expect this will be removed within 15 days of receipt of this letter so I will not have to take any further action to ensure that you report my credit dealings accurately

Unfortunately you can't make the 15 days stick - they get 30 days for a 'reinvestigation' and that's about all you can enforce -- to some degree. If you got your credit report thru annualcreditreport.com (free), then they actually get 45 days.

Other than that it looks ok.

Decided I would call ANFI and confirm the date the account was opened. I called their corporate headquarters and they transferred me to someone internally (Teresa). I gave her the ANFI acct. number but declined to give her my SS#. She found the accounts with no problem and confirmed they had been placed after the BK7 and should have been deleted since they had rec'd it after the date of my BK. She sent off a (her words) "manual delete request" that should take these off completely instead of the automatic updates they send usually. Said it could take up to 30 days for it to actually get off the reports but to call back if there was any further problem.
